Light-responsive nanogated ensemble based on polymer grafted mesoporous silica hybrid nanoparticles.

Jinping Lai1, Xue Mu, Yunyan Xu, Xiaoli Wu, Chuanliu Wu, Chong Li, Jianbin Chen, Yibing Zhao.   

Abstract

Mesoporous silica nanoparticles grafted with light-responsive polymer on the outer surface were developed as novel nanogated ensembles, which allow encapsulation and release of drug and biological molecules under light irradiation.
